Field Staff Position
The primary responsibility of Field Staff is to provide exemplary service and support on site for the program. The Field Staff are the front lines of the program frequently interacting with clients. They are expected to be presentable and knowledgeable about their positions as they drive the guest experience and can be the front lines for troubleshooting on site. Field staff are expected to follow the directions outlined in their trip sheets and report guest experiences and any issues back to the Account Manager.
MajorAreas of Accountability:
- Staff are required to always demonstrate professional dialogue and behavior with other staff, representatives of DCi, vendor contacts, clients, and event attendees.
- Staff will be capable of standing for the duration of their shift. Shift types vary, either inside and/or outside.
- Staff will communicate with the Staffing Department about shift availability, cancellations, and time restraints prior to trip sheet confirmation.
- Staff will be provided with uniforms, badges, and clipboards and will be required to bring them to every shift unless otherwise specified by the Account Manager of the program.
- Staff must show up on time for their shift, as specified in the trip sheet.
- Staff will maintain their calendars to prevent overbooking.
- Staff may be required to provide information/narration about the specific area where their shift is to take place. If a staff is unable to provide general information about their respective region, they must inform the Staffing Specialist so it can be addressed prior to their shift start.
- Staff must know the location and general specifics about the venue in which they are assigned to work.
- Staff must read and confirm their trip sheet details within 24 hours of trip sheets being sent via email.
- Staff must input their hours and expenses into ADP payroll system each Sunday.
- Staff must retain receipts for reimbursements
- Staff must be able to lift 25lbs.
- Staff must recognize potential problems and risks before they arise and bring attention to the on-site lead or Account Manager.
- Staff must be familiar with emergency protocols at their venue such as locations of emergency exits, location of first aid kit, where security is located, being aware of guests with special needs, location of fire extinguishers, and chain of command in emergency procedures.
- Staff must be familiar with airports, managing manifests, communicating with on-site leads, and transportation vendors.
- Staff must greet the attendee(s), assist with retrieving luggage carts if needed, and direct them to their transportation.
- Staff must count the attendees getting on a vehicle to ensure there is enough capacity on the vehicle for transfer.
- Staff must communicate problems that arise calmly, never in front of attendees, to on-site supervisor or lead.
- Staff must communicate any lost luggage to the on-site supervisor or lead.
- Staff must follow transportation requirements.
- Upon arrival of the vehicle, staff will introduce themselves to the driver.
- Staff must be familiar with the route to the venue, drop off and pick up locations for each venue and give guidance to vendor drivers as needed.
- Staff should be aware of changes in traffic on any given day. (Road closures, construction, etc.)
- Staff will confirm signage on the vehicle is correct before assisting guests over to the vehicle.
- Staff will place belongings on reserved seat for themself at the front of the vehicle if required to ride with attendees.
- Staff will discuss itinerary and special accommodations with the on-site lead or supervisor at the briefing.
- When on a vehicle, staff must pay attention to the route and correct drivers as needed.
- Staff will always be personable and respectful to attendees.
- Staff will ensure that all attendees are present for pick up and drop off and have a plan for those who do not show up dictated by the on-site lead or supervisor prior to the event.
- Staff will record the number of passengers, names on a list, and/or time the vehicle leaves the curb as directed by the on-site lead or supervisor.
